Alginate-Based Hybrid Materials for the Treatment of Textile Dyes,hem have its own merits and demerits in terms of operation, efficiency, design, and total cost. This chapter provides a brief review of the use of alginates and alginate-based hybrid materials for the removal of textile dyes from wastewater.
